The Security Service of Ukraine (SBU) uncovered a Kyiv-based IT company that attempted to illegally transfer confidential information from the electronic systems of the frontline OVA to representatives of the Donetsk People's Republic (DNR) terrorist organization. The investigation revealed that the company had granted access to the databases to its colleagues from the temporarily occupied part of the region, who were posing as employees of the company's Donetsk branch. If successful, the offenders would have been able to regularly leak information from the OVA. The perpetrators of this crime face up to 15 years in prison with confiscation of property.

Arthur Walker, Jr, had a big, often-overlooked influence in space science. He pioneered using x-rays to study activity on the Sun, led the Challenger investigation, and opened opportunities for underrepresented groups in astronomy. skyandtelescope.org/astronomy- #Juneteenth #BlackInStem
